What you need for this book
Those interested in partaking in this adventure with us will require a computer capable of running either the Eclipse IDE or a Sublime Text editor, preferably Sublime Text 3. We have chosen to demonstrate our examples based on the Eclipse IDE; however, Sublime Text users can also complete the exercises. Depending on your choice, either the Force.com IDE plugin for Eclipse or its open source counterpart, MavensMate for Sublime Text will need to be installed.
In addition to the aforementioned software, those wishing to write the code and test it out on the platform will also need a free developer account available from Salesforce (covered in Chapter 1, Apex Assumptions and Comparisons) or a paid license with Apex enabled (either a platform license or Sales Cloud Enterprise or higher).